崗位職責(zé):
1、?根據(jù)產(chǎn)品和項(xiàng)目需求,分析、設(shè)計(jì)與實(shí)現(xiàn)系統(tǒng)架構(gòu)方案,進(jìn)行系統(tǒng)技術(shù)平臺(tái)的選型和評(píng)估新技術(shù)的可行性,保障系統(tǒng)架構(gòu)的合理性、可擴(kuò)展性及前瞻性;
2、?負(fù)責(zé)產(chǎn)品架構(gòu)分析,提出軟件架構(gòu)整體設(shè)計(jì),數(shù)據(jù)庫(kù)存儲(chǔ)設(shè)計(jì)方案,制定系統(tǒng)自上而下設(shè)計(jì)相關(guān)的技術(shù)接口和規(guī)范;
3、?負(fù)責(zé)業(yè)務(wù)建模、系統(tǒng)分析、子系統(tǒng)劃分,完成概要設(shè)計(jì)和數(shù)據(jù)庫(kù)結(jié)構(gòu)設(shè)計(jì)等,撰寫相關(guān)技術(shù)文檔;
4、?負(fù)責(zé)核心技術(shù)問(wèn)題的攻關(guān),系統(tǒng)優(yōu)化,參與編寫系統(tǒng)核心代碼,協(xié)助解決項(xiàng)目開發(fā)過(guò)程中的技術(shù)難題;
5、?負(fù)責(zé)對(duì)系統(tǒng)框架相關(guān)技術(shù)和業(yè)務(wù)進(jìn)行培訓(xùn),指導(dǎo)開發(fā)人員開發(fā);
6、?積極了解業(yè)界發(fā)展、研究相關(guān)新技術(shù)及趨勢(shì),組織公司技術(shù)路線規(guī)劃設(shè)計(jì),促進(jìn)技術(shù)進(jìn)步和創(chuàng)新;
7、?完成上級(jí)交辦的其它工作。
崗位要求:
1、?全日制本科(985、211)及以上學(xué)歷;
2、?3年及以上工作經(jīng)驗(yàn),具備豐富的大中型開發(fā)項(xiàng)目的總體規(guī)劃、方案設(shè)計(jì)及技術(shù)隊(duì)伍管理經(jīng)驗(yàn);
3、?對(duì)JAVA技術(shù)及整個(gè)解決方案有深刻的理解及熟練的應(yīng)用,并且精通WebService/J2EE?架構(gòu)和設(shè)計(jì)模式,并在此基礎(chǔ)上設(shè)計(jì)產(chǎn)品框架;
4、?具有面向?qū)ο蠓治?、設(shè)計(jì)、開發(fā)能力(OOA、OOD、OOP),精通UML,熟練使用Visio、PowerDesigner?等工具進(jìn)行設(shè)計(jì)開發(fā);
5、?精通大型數(shù)據(jù)庫(kù)如Oracle、Mysql等的開發(fā)。熟悉Redis、Memcached、Mangodb等主流的NoSQL數(shù)據(jù)庫(kù)。熟悉Weblogic/Tomcat/JBoss等主流應(yīng)用服務(wù)器;
6、?對(duì)計(jì)算機(jī)系統(tǒng)、網(wǎng)絡(luò)和安全、應(yīng)用系統(tǒng)架構(gòu)等有全面的認(rèn)識(shí),熟悉項(xiàng)目管理理論,并有實(shí)踐基礎(chǔ);
7、?精通主流SOA開發(fā)框架,了解SOA系統(tǒng)開發(fā)設(shè)計(jì),有WebService、RESTful相關(guān)開發(fā)經(jīng)驗(yàn),精通dubbo,muleESB等框架;
8、?熟悉微服務(wù)架構(gòu),能搭建基于SpringCloud的開發(fā)框架;
9、?對(duì)工作充滿激情,有責(zé)任心,能承受工作壓力,良好的語(yǔ)言表達(dá)及溝通能力、拓展能力及組織協(xié)調(diào)能力,良好的職業(yè)素質(zhì)。